How Do I Select the Right Floral Arrangement for Different Occasions?
Selecting appropriate botanical compositions depends on event context, symbolism, and environmental conditions at the destination venue.
Matching Flowers to Cultural and Corporate Milestones
Different environments demand distinct aesthetic weights. Corporate product launches require structured, monochromatic color schemes that project professionalism. Conversely, family milestones call for vibrant, mixed-texture bouquets.
| Occasion Type | Primary Flower Species | Structural Style | Target Longevity |
| Corporate Meet | Anthuriums, White Lilies | Minimalist Linear | 7 to 10 Days |
| Wedding Reception | Ecuadorian Roses, Orchids | Dense Cascading | 5 to 7 Days |
| Sympathy Tribute | Chrysanthemums, Carnations | Round Traditional | 7 to 14 Days |
| Housewarming | Gerberas, Sunflowers | Hand-Tied Bunches | 5 to 8 Days |
Evaluating Color Palettes and Fragrance Profiles
Color theory dictates visual impact. I advise clients on contrast and harmony. Deep red roses create immediate focal points, while pastel carnations and baby's breath offer subtle background texture. Furthermore, I monitor fragrance intensity, avoiding heavily scented varieties like oriental lilies in enclosed, air-conditioned office spaces where strong aromas can overwhelm occupants.

Why Choose Expert Local Florist Services Over Standard Aggregators?
Mass-market aggregators outsource orders to third-party vendors, resulting in variable quality and lack of direct accountability. Operating independently allows me to maintain absolute oversight over every stem that leaves my workshop.
Direct Quality Control and Temperature Management

Sourcing Fresh Blooms from Trusted Growers
I bypass multi-layered distribution brokers by partnering directly with established cultivators in regional greenhouse hubs. This direct pipeline reduces transit lag by up to 48 hours, ensuring that flowers arrive at the client's location in peak developmental condition.

Managing Logistics Across Regional Corridors
Transporting delicate stems across state lines from New Delhi to Gurugram demands rigid packaging. I secure heavy ceramic and glass vessels inside custom-molded corrugated cartons lined with high-density polyethylene foam inserts. This absorbs vibrational shock during transit along high-speed transit routes.
Ensuring Hand-Carried Transit Integrity
Courier personnel place boxes upright within temperature-regulated vehicle cabins. Stacking boxes vertically is strictly prohibited. I assign dedicated delivery runners who understand how to handle fragile botanical compositions without tilting or compressing the blooms.

How Do I Maintain Freshness and Longevity After Delivery?
Providing care instructions educates clients on post-delivery handling, ensuring maximum vase life and aesthetic appeal.
Stem Re-cutting and Hydration Protocols
Recutting stems at a 45-degree angle under clean running water prevents air embolism from blocking vascular bundles. I instruct clients to remove all submerged foliage to inhibit bacterial growth in the nutrient solution.
Optimal Environmental Placement Guidelines
Placing arrangements away from direct sunlight, ripening fruit bowls, and drafty air-conditioning vents prevents premature dehydration. Ethylene gas emitted by ripening fruit accelerates petal drop; therefore, spatial separation is essential.
